This sound is a brief meme clip centered on CaseOh saying shrimp alfredo and then stretching out an excited yeah. The delivery is loud, exaggerated and instantly silly, which makes the line feel bigger than the words themselves. Even if you do not know the original stream context, the audio lands as a funny burst of hype for something random and specific. That contrast is what gives it meme value: it can turn an ordinary food mention, small success or weird craving into a dramatic comedic moment.

This clip is associated with CaseOh and circulates online as a food-focused reaction meme. Short edits usually isolate the phrase shrimp alfredo and the extended celebratory yell, then reuse it in TikTok-style jokes, stream compilations and reaction posts. Its staying power comes from how specific the phrase is compared with how dramatic the delivery sounds. That mismatch makes it easy to drop into unrelated cooking clips, appetite jokes and exaggerated victory edits without needing much setup.
